/art/libartbase/base/ |
D | intrusive_forward_list_test.cc | 143 using ValueType = typename ListType::value_type; in IteratorOperators() typedef 153 ValueType value(1); in IteratorOperators() 168 using ValueType = typename ListType::value_type; in ConstructRange() typedef 170 std::vector<ValueType> storage(ref.begin(), ref.end()); in ConstructRange() 183 using ValueType = typename ListType::value_type; in Assign() typedef 185 std::vector<ValueType> storage1(ref1.begin(), ref1.end()); in Assign() 190 std::vector<ValueType> storage2(ref2.begin(), ref2.end()); in Assign() 203 using ValueType = typename ListType::value_type; in PushPop() typedef 204 ValueType value3(3); in PushPop() 205 ValueType value7(7); in PushPop() [all …]
|
D | transform_array_ref.h | 171 template <typename ValueType, typename Function> 172 TransformArrayRef<ValueType, Function> MakeTransformArrayRef( in MakeTransformArrayRef() 173 ArrayRef<ValueType> container, Function f) { in MakeTransformArrayRef() 174 return TransformArrayRef<ValueType, Function>(container, f); in MakeTransformArrayRef()
|
/art/runtime/interpreter/ |
D | interpreter_common.cc | 577 static ObjPtr<mirror::Class> GetClassForBootstrapArgument(EncodedArrayValueIterator::ValueType type) in GetClassForBootstrapArgument() 582 case EncodedArrayValueIterator::ValueType::kBoolean: in GetClassForBootstrapArgument() 583 case EncodedArrayValueIterator::ValueType::kByte: in GetClassForBootstrapArgument() 584 case EncodedArrayValueIterator::ValueType::kChar: in GetClassForBootstrapArgument() 585 case EncodedArrayValueIterator::ValueType::kShort: in GetClassForBootstrapArgument() 589 case EncodedArrayValueIterator::ValueType::kInt: in GetClassForBootstrapArgument() 591 case EncodedArrayValueIterator::ValueType::kLong: in GetClassForBootstrapArgument() 593 case EncodedArrayValueIterator::ValueType::kFloat: in GetClassForBootstrapArgument() 595 case EncodedArrayValueIterator::ValueType::kDouble: in GetClassForBootstrapArgument() 597 case EncodedArrayValueIterator::ValueType::kMethodType: in GetClassForBootstrapArgument() [all …]
|
/art/test/712-varhandle-invocations/util-src/ |
D | generate_java.py | 46 class ValueType(JavaType): class 77 BOOLEAN_TYPE = ValueType("boolean", "Boolean", [ "true", "false" ], ordinal = 0, width = 1, support… 78 BYTE_TYPE=ValueType("byte", "Byte", [ "(byte) -128", "(byte) -61", "(byte) 7", "(byte) 127", "(byte… 79 SHORT_TYPE=ValueType("short", "Short", [ "(short) -32768", "(short) -384", "(short) 32767", "(short… 80 CHAR_TYPE=ValueType("char", "Character", [ r"'A'", r"'#'", r"'$'", r"'Z'", r"'t'", r"'c'", r"Chara… 81 INT_TYPE=ValueType("int", "Integer", [ "-0x01234567", "0x7f6e5d4c", "0x12345678", "0x10215220", "42… 82 LONG_TYPE=ValueType("long", "Long", [ "-0x0123456789abcdefl", "0x789abcdef0123456l", "0xfedcba98765… 83 FLOAT_TYPE=ValueType("float", "Float", [ "-7.77e23f", "1.234e-17f", "3.40e36f", "-8.888e3f", "4.442… 84 DOUBLE_TYPE=ValueType("double", "Double", [ "-1.0e-200", "1.11e200", "3.141", "1.1111", "6.022e23",…
|
/art/dex2oat/linker/ |
D | image_writer.h | 608 template <typename ValueType> 609 void CopyAndFixupPointer(void** target, ValueType src_value, PointerSize pointer_size) 611 template <typename ValueType> 612 void CopyAndFixupPointer(void** target, ValueType src_value) 614 template <typename ValueType> 616 void* object, MemberOffset offset, ValueType src_value, PointerSize pointer_size) 618 template <typename ValueType> 619 void CopyAndFixupPointer(void* object, MemberOffset offset, ValueType src_value)
|
D | image_writer.cc | 3641 template <typename ValueType> 3643 void** target, ValueType src_value, PointerSize pointer_size) { in CopyAndFixupPointer() 3654 template <typename ValueType> 3655 void ImageWriter::CopyAndFixupPointer(void** target, ValueType src_value) in CopyAndFixupPointer() 3660 template <typename ValueType> 3662 void* object, MemberOffset offset, ValueType src_value, PointerSize pointer_size) { in CopyAndFixupPointer() 3668 template <typename ValueType> 3669 void ImageWriter::CopyAndFixupPointer(void* object, MemberOffset offset, ValueType src_value) { in CopyAndFixupPointer()
|
/art/dexdump/ |
D | dexdump.cc | 1825 case EncodedArrayValueIterator::ValueType::kByte: in dumpCallSite() 1829 case EncodedArrayValueIterator::ValueType::kShort: in dumpCallSite() 1833 case EncodedArrayValueIterator::ValueType::kChar: in dumpCallSite() 1837 case EncodedArrayValueIterator::ValueType::kInt: in dumpCallSite() 1841 case EncodedArrayValueIterator::ValueType::kLong: in dumpCallSite() 1845 case EncodedArrayValueIterator::ValueType::kFloat: in dumpCallSite() 1849 case EncodedArrayValueIterator::ValueType::kDouble: in dumpCallSite() 1853 case EncodedArrayValueIterator::ValueType::kMethodType: { in dumpCallSite() 1860 case EncodedArrayValueIterator::ValueType::kMethodHandle: in dumpCallSite() 1864 case EncodedArrayValueIterator::ValueType::kString: { in dumpCallSite() [all …]
|
/art/dexlayout/ |
D | dexlayout.cc | 1716 if ((*it)->Type() != EncodedArrayValueIterator::ValueType::kMethodHandle) { in DumpCallSite() 1725 if ((*it)->Type() != EncodedArrayValueIterator::ValueType::kString) { in DumpCallSite() 1734 if ((*it)->Type() != EncodedArrayValueIterator::ValueType::kMethodType) { in DumpCallSite() 1756 case EncodedArrayValueIterator::ValueType::kByte: in DumpCallSite() 1760 case EncodedArrayValueIterator::ValueType::kShort: in DumpCallSite() 1764 case EncodedArrayValueIterator::ValueType::kChar: in DumpCallSite() 1768 case EncodedArrayValueIterator::ValueType::kInt: in DumpCallSite() 1772 case EncodedArrayValueIterator::ValueType::kLong: in DumpCallSite() 1776 case EncodedArrayValueIterator::ValueType::kFloat: in DumpCallSite() 1780 case EncodedArrayValueIterator::ValueType::kDouble: in DumpCallSite() [all …]
|
/art/libdexfile/dex/ |
D | dex_file_verifier.cc | 1140 EncodedArrayValueIterator::ValueType array_type = array_it.GetValueType(); in CheckStaticFieldTypes() 1143 case EncodedArrayValueIterator::ValueType::kBoolean: in CheckStaticFieldTypes() 1150 case EncodedArrayValueIterator::ValueType::kByte: in CheckStaticFieldTypes() 1157 case EncodedArrayValueIterator::ValueType::kShort: in CheckStaticFieldTypes() 1164 case EncodedArrayValueIterator::ValueType::kChar: in CheckStaticFieldTypes() 1171 case EncodedArrayValueIterator::ValueType::kInt: in CheckStaticFieldTypes() 1178 case EncodedArrayValueIterator::ValueType::kLong: in CheckStaticFieldTypes() 1185 case EncodedArrayValueIterator::ValueType::kFloat: in CheckStaticFieldTypes() 1192 case EncodedArrayValueIterator::ValueType::kDouble: in CheckStaticFieldTypes() 1199 case EncodedArrayValueIterator::ValueType::kNull: in CheckStaticFieldTypes() [all …]
|
D | dex_file.h | 990 enum ValueType { enum 1011 ValueType GetValueType() const { return type_; } in GetValueType() 1022 ValueType type_; // Type of current encoded value. 1028 std::ostream& operator<<(std::ostream& os, EncodedArrayValueIterator::ValueType code);
|
D | dex_file.cc | 630 DCHECK_EQ(EncodedArrayValueIterator::ValueType::kMethodType, it.GetValueType()); in GetProtoIndexForCallSite() 665 type_ = static_cast<ValueType>(value_type & kEncodedValueTypeMask); in Next()
|
/art/runtime/ |
D | runtime_image.cc | 1441 case EncodedArrayValueIterator::ValueType::kBoolean: in TryInitializeClass() 1444 case EncodedArrayValueIterator::ValueType::kByte: in TryInitializeClass() 1447 case EncodedArrayValueIterator::ValueType::kShort: in TryInitializeClass() 1450 case EncodedArrayValueIterator::ValueType::kChar: in TryInitializeClass() 1453 case EncodedArrayValueIterator::ValueType::kInt: in TryInitializeClass() 1456 case EncodedArrayValueIterator::ValueType::kLong: in TryInitializeClass() 1459 case EncodedArrayValueIterator::ValueType::kFloat: in TryInitializeClass() 1462 case EncodedArrayValueIterator::ValueType::kDouble: in TryInitializeClass() 1465 case EncodedArrayValueIterator::ValueType::kNull: in TryInitializeClass() 1468 case EncodedArrayValueIterator::ValueType::kString: { in TryInitializeClass() [all …]
|
/art/compiler/optimizing/ |
D | instruction_builder.cc | 1536 case EncodedArrayValueIterator::ValueType::kBoolean: in HasTrivialClinit() 1537 case EncodedArrayValueIterator::ValueType::kByte: in HasTrivialClinit() 1538 case EncodedArrayValueIterator::ValueType::kShort: in HasTrivialClinit() 1539 case EncodedArrayValueIterator::ValueType::kChar: in HasTrivialClinit() 1540 case EncodedArrayValueIterator::ValueType::kInt: in HasTrivialClinit() 1541 case EncodedArrayValueIterator::ValueType::kLong: in HasTrivialClinit() 1542 case EncodedArrayValueIterator::ValueType::kFloat: in HasTrivialClinit() 1543 case EncodedArrayValueIterator::ValueType::kDouble: in HasTrivialClinit() 1544 case EncodedArrayValueIterator::ValueType::kNull: in HasTrivialClinit() 1545 case EncodedArrayValueIterator::ValueType::kString: in HasTrivialClinit() [all …]
|
D | nodes.h | 749 template <class InstructionType, typename ValueType> 750 InstructionType* CreateConstant(ValueType value, 751 ArenaSafeMap<ValueType, InstructionType*>* cache,
|
/art/runtime/verifier/ |
D | method_verifier.cc | 4061 std::pair<const EncodedArrayValueIterator::ValueType, size_t> type_and_max[kRequiredArguments] = in CheckCallSite() 4062 { { EncodedArrayValueIterator::ValueType::kMethodHandle, dex_file_->NumMethodHandles() }, in CheckCallSite() 4063 { EncodedArrayValueIterator::ValueType::kString, dex_file_->NumStringIds() }, in CheckCallSite() 4064 { EncodedArrayValueIterator::ValueType::kMethodType, dex_file_->NumProtoIds() } in CheckCallSite()
|